Ethanol fires don't produce smoke, ash, or carcinogenic byproducts, which makes them safe for indoor use. They are also very easy to use.

Install your fireplace in a suitable space and fill it up with fuel ethanol. Then, light it with an extended lighter and enjoy the flames.

A lot of ethanol fireplaces are freestanding. However wall-mounted models are available and can be set up in a matter of minutes. They are popular for preserving space in the interior.

Choose an Ethanol fireplace that is UL-certified and safe for use. Also, look for models that come equipped with automatic shut-off mechanisms as well as locks that are childproof. These features will ensure that if you accidentally knock the fireplace over or children are interested in it the flames will be swiftly extinguished.

Also, make sure to place your fireplace with ethanol in a space that is well-ventilated, and of sufficient size. This will help reduce the risk of vapor leaks or failure of combustion, as well as flammable fumes. The heat from the flames could damage material and objects that are combustible.

Ethanol Fireplaces are an excellent option for those looking to add a touch of elegance to their home that is also environmentally friendly. They are simple to use and require minimal maintenance. They are also more secure than traditional fireplaces with wood burning. This makes them a great option for families with pets or small children.

But, despite their numerous advantages, ethanol fireplaces aren't intended to be a primary source of heat. They are best used as an accent or to complement existing heating systems. They should be kept out of from combustibles and placed in the way that they won't be trampled by people or objects. In addition, they should never be left unattended. In the event that these safety precautions aren't followed there is a risk of a fire arising, causing serious injuries and property damage. It is recommended that you hire an expert to set up your ethanol fireplace properly and safely.

Make sure you be aware of all the instructions before installing a bio-ethanol fireplace. These instructions are tailored to the model and will guide you through every step of installation. It is also recommended to be sure to avoid placing your fireplace in proximity to things that ignite, like curtains or other decor. If you decide to put the fireplace into your wall, you should make sure that it is made from non-flammable materials like stone or wonderboard.

bio-ethanol-burner-tornado-black-fireplace-glass-burner-fire-bioethanol-flame-tornado-hurricane-956.jpgRefueling your fireplace requires that you shut off the fire and let the burner box cool before refilling. This will minimize the chance of an accident spill and also prevent the nozzle from getting blocked. Also, make sure that you don't add fuel to the burner when the flame is burning or has recently been snuffed out.

You should also put your fireplace in an area that is well ventilated and has the right dimensions. This is to ensure that the vapor produced by the combustion of ethanol does not escape and pollute the ambient air or cause injuries or carbon monoxide poisoning.
